Nerve endings on adrenaline cells in male rat adrenal medullas were investigated by quantitative electron microscopy, with sampling at 8 times during a standard light: dark (12:12) photoperiod. Number (N) per unit area of 2 vesicle types (small clear vesicle, SCV; large granular vesicle, LGV) and % of LGV per total vesicle N were determined. Normal (non-operated) animals showed a circadian rhythm (p less than 0.005) in mean SCVN and one with nearly opposite phase relations in % LGVN. Doubly sham-operated animals had a similar rhythm in %LGVN but diminished circadian change in SCVN. Pinealectomized animals had a circadian pattern in SCVN, but this differed from that of normals in having a 2nd peak, a delay or phase shift of the primary peak, and an increased amplitude of the rhythmic changes.
